"dubbo 最新源码"涉及的是著名开源框架Dubbo的核心组件及其源代码。Dubbo是一款高性能、轻量级的Java服务治理框架,它由阿里巴巴开发并开源,旨在提高微服务间的通信效率,提供服务治理、监控和服务发现等功能。 中的"dubbo-admin"指的是Dubbo的服务管理控制台,它提供了对服务的注册、发现、监控和管理功能,允许开发者查看服务状态、调用关系、服务性能等关键指标。"dubbo-cluster"是集群模块,它负责服务的负载均衡、容错和路由策略,确保服务的高可用性和稳定性。"dubbo-common"是通用模块,包含了一些基础工具类和公共组件,是Dubbo其他模块的基础。 "dubbo 源码"强调了我们关注的重点在于理解Dubbo的内部实现机制,通过阅读源码,开发者可以深入学习其设计思想,如服务治理的实现、RPC调用流程、元数据管理等,这对于优化服务、解决实际问题或开发类似框架具有重要价值。 【压缩包子文件的文件名称列表】中,"UserGuide-zh-Dubbo_20130110.pdf"可能是一份中文版的Dubbo用户指南,包含了框架的基本使用方法、配置详解和最佳实践。"dubbo简介及在消息系统中的应用.ppt"可能是一个关于Dubbo的介绍性演示文稿,涵盖了Dubbo的基本概念以及在消息系统中的应用场景,有助于理解Dubbo如何与其他组件集成,如消息队列(MQ)等。"Dubbo资料"可能是其他相关的文档、教程或案例研究集合,可以帮助读者更全面地了解Dubbo。 通过对这些资源的学习,我们可以深入理解以下知识点: 1. **Dubbo架构**:Dubbo采用 Provider-Consumer 模型,服务提供者(Provider)发布服务,服务消费者(Consumer)调用服务,中间通过 Registry 进行服务注册与发现。 2. **RPC机制**:Dubbo的核心是基于远程过程调用(RPC)的,包括服务请求的序列化、反序列化、网络传输以及服务调用的异步处理等。 3. **服务治理**:包括服务注册与发现、服务版本管理、服务分组、服务路由、服务降级、熔断和限流等,这些都是通过dubbo-admin进行可视化的管理和监控。 4. **集群策略**:如轮询、随机、优先级、最少活跃调用数等负载均衡策略,以及故障转移、失败重试等容错机制。 5. **协议与序列化**:Dubbo支持多种通信协议(如HTTP、TCP、Hessian等)和序列化方式(如Java自带序列化、Google Protobuf等),可以根据性能需求选择合适的组合。 6. **扩展点**:Dubbo的插件化设计使得开发者可以自定义拦截器、过滤器、协议、序列化方式等,增强框架的功能。 7. **服务监控**:Dubbo内置了监控中心,可以统计服务的调用次数、耗时等信息,帮助开发者实时监控服务健康状态。 8. **消息系统集成**:通过与RabbitMQ、Kafka等消息队列集成,可以实现服务间的异步通信和解耦。 通过深入学习和实践,开发者不仅可以熟练使用Dubbo构建分布式系统,还能具备对服务治理、微服务架构的深入理解,为构建复杂的企业级应用打下坚实基础。
- 1
- 粉丝: 1
- 资源: 19
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- Untitled7.ipynb
- C#ASP.NET酒店管理系统源码 宾馆管理系统源码数据库 SQL2008源码类型 WebForm
- 【安卓毕业设计】基于安卓的奶牛管理源码(完整前后端+mysql+说明文档).zip
- 【安卓毕业设计】Android app作业源码(完整前后端+mysql+说明文档).zip
- Scrapy基础(讲解详细、包括框架流程代码实战,最佳学习资料).zip
- FPGA实现IIC通信quartus工程,纯verliog,可进行移植
- C#ASP.NET外贸订单管理系统源码 汽配订单管理系统源码数据库 SQL2008源码类型 WebForm
- 基于双流Faster R-CNN网络的图像篡改检测项目源码+训练好的模型+文档说明.zip
- 买的USB转485串口的驱动程序,使用的是美国TI芯片+WCH340芯片
- 二次平台培训视频,人事管理
- 1
- 2
前往页